"""Bazel providers for Android rules."""
load("//rules:visibility.bzl", "PROJECT_VISIBILITY")
visibility(PROJECT_VISIBILITY)
AndroidAppsInfo = provider(
doc = "Provides information about app to install.",
fields = dict(
apps = "List of app provider artifacts.",
),
)
AndroidFilteredJdepsInfo = provider(
doc = "Provides a filtered jdeps proto.",
fields = dict(
jdeps = "Filtered jdeps",
),
)
StarlarkApkInfo = provider(
doc = "Provides APK outputs of a rule.",
fields = dict(
keystore = "Keystore used to sign the APK. Deprecated, prefer signing_keys.",
signing_keys = "List of keys used to sign the APK",
signing_lineage = "Optional sigining lineage file",
signed_apk = "Signed APK",
unsigned_apk = "Unsigned APK",
),
)
ResourcesNodeInfo = provider(
doc = "Provides information for building ResourceProcessorBusyBox flags",
fields = dict(
label = "A label, the target's label",
# Assets related fields
assets = "A depset of files, assets files of the target",
assets_dir = "A string, the name of the assets directory",
assets_symbols = "A file, the merged assets",
compiled_assets = "A file, the compiled assets",
# Dynamic resources field
resource_apks = "A depset of resource only apk files",
# Resource related fields
resource_files = "A depset of files, resource files of the target",
compiled_resources = "A file, the compiled resources",
r_txt = "A file, the R.txt file",
manifest = "A file, the AndroidManifest.xml",
# TODO(ostonge): Add the manifest if it's exported, otherwise leave empty
exports_manifest = "Boolean, whether the manifest is exported",
),
)
StarlarkAndroidResourcesInfo = provider(
doc = "Provides information about direct and transitive resources",
fields = dict(
direct_resources_nodes = "Depset of ResourcesNodeInfo providers, can contain multiple providers due to exports",
transitive_resources_nodes = "Depset of transitive ResourcesNodeInfo providers, not including directs",
transitive_assets = "Depset of transitive assets files",
transitive_assets_symbols = "Depset of transitive merged assets",
transitive_compiled_assets = "Depset of transitive compiled assets",
direct_compiled_resources = "Depset of direct compiled_resources, can contain multiple files due to exports",
transitive_compiled_resources = "Depset of transitive compiled resources",
transitive_manifests = "Depset of transitive manifests",
transitive_r_txts = "Depset of transitive R.txt files",
transitive_resource_files = "Depset of transitive resource files",
packages_to_r_txts = "Map of packages to depset of r_txt files",
transitive_resource_apks = "Depset of transitive resource only apk files",
package = "String, the package used for the generated Java resources",
),
)

AndroidFeatureModuleInfo = provider(
doc = "Contains data required to build an Android feature split.",
fields = dict(
binary = "String, target of the underlying split android_binary target",
feature_name = "String, the name of the feature module. If unspecified, the target name will be used.",
fused = "Boolean, whether the split is \"fused\" for the system image and for pre-L devices.",
library = "String, target of the underlying split android_library target",
manifest = "Optional AndroidManifest.xml file to use for this feature.",
min_sdk_version = "String, the min SDK version for this feature.",
title_id = "String, resource identifier for the split title.",
title_lib = "String, target of the split title android_library.",
is_asset_pack = "Boolean, whether this feature module is an asset pack. AI packs are a type of asset pack.",
),
)
Dex2OatApkInfo = provider(
doc = "Contains data about artifacts generated through host dex2oat.",
fields = dict(
signed_apk = "Signed APK",
oat_file = "Oat file generated through dex2oat.",
vdex_file = "Vdex file generated through dex2oat.",
art_file = "ART file generated through dex2oat.",
),
)

AndroidSandboxedSdkInfo = provider(
doc = "Provides information about a sandboxed Android SDK.",
fields = dict(
internal_apk_info = "ApkInfo for SDKs dexes and resources. Note: it cannot " +
"be installed on a device as is. It needs to be further processed by " +
"other sandboxed SDK rules.",
sdk_module_config = "The SDK Module config. For the full definition see " +
"https://github.com/google/bundletool/blob/master/src/main/proto/sdk_modules_config.proto",
sdk_api_descriptors = "Jar file with the SDK API Descriptors. This can later be used to " +
"generate sources for communicating with this SDK from the app " +
"process.",
),
)
AndroidArchivedSandboxedSdkInfo = provider(
doc = "Provides information about an Android Sandboxed SDK archive.",
fields = dict(
asar = "Android Sandboxed SDK archive file, as generated by Bundletool.",
sdk_api_descriptors = "Jar file with the SDK API Descriptors. This can later be used to " +
"generate sources for communicating with this SDK from the app " +
"process.",
),
)
AndroidSandboxedSdkBundleInfo = provider(
doc = "Provides information about a sandboxed Android SDK Bundle (ASB).",
fields = dict(
sdk_info = "AndroidSandboxedSdkInfo with information about the SDK.",
asb = "Path to the final ASB, unsigned.",
),
)
AndroidSandboxedSdkApkInfo = provider(
doc = "Provides information about App and Sandboxed SDK APKs.",
fields = dict(
app_apk_info = "ApkInfo for the host app.",
sandboxed_sdk_apks = "List of APKs for sandboxed SDK dependencies of the host app. " +
"Only present when compat splits are not requested. APKs are signed " +
"with debug keys.",
sandboxed_sdk_splits = "List of APK splits that contain the sandboxed SDK dependencies " +
"of the host app. Only present when compat splits are requested.",
),
)
